The updated premiere-week calendar
Here is the current plan in order:
- Tuesday, July 7 at 12 PM ET / 9 AM PT: Big Brother: Broveal streams on the official Big Brother YouTube channel, with Julie Chen Moonves introducing the new Houseguests and showing more of the Time Trip house.
- Thursday, July 9 at 8 PM ET/PT: BB28 premieres on CBS with a 90-minute episode.
- Friday, July 10 at 8 PM ET/PT: Big Brother: Unlocked premieres with Jerry O'Connell, Taylor Hale, and Derrick Levasseur on the panel.
- Friday, July 10 at 9 PM ET / 6 PM PT: 24/7 live feeds launch on Paramount+ and Pluto TV. YouTube also gets limited live-feed windows after episodes throughout the season.
- Sunday, July 12 at 8 PM ET/PT: The second main-series episode airs as another 90-minute installment.
After premiere week, CBS says the season settles into Wednesdays, Thursdays, and Sundays at 8 PM ET/PT, with Wednesdays running 90 minutes and Thursdays carrying live evictions.
What changed since the first watch plan
Three big pending items have moved into the confirmed column.
First, the cast reveal has a time and platform: YouTube, July 7, noon ET. That is the moment the cast board can start moving from placeholder to official records.
Second, the live feeds have a launch time. They do not start right after the July 9 premiere. They open the next night, after Unlocked, at 9 PM ET on July 10.
Third, Unlocked has its panel. Jerry O'Connell joins returning winners Taylor Hale and Derrick Levasseur, with the aftershow also getting a live studio audience.
What still belongs in the watch column
The cast names are about to become official, but the format may not be fully solved by the Broveal. Entertainment Weekly points out that Julie Chen Moonves has hinted at familiar reality-show faces, and recent seasons have sometimes saved familiar-face reveals for the premiere itself. So if the YouTube event gives us a clean cast list, great. If it leaves a door open, we should keep that door labeled as open rather than filling it with rumor.
The same goes for the Time Trip mechanics. CBS has confirmed the theme, the house language, and the promise of powers and challenges. The exact game rules still need on-screen receipts.
